Whether where you live, you should always be aware of the natural fuel smell surrounding you. No matter the season, it is important to maintain your senses alert to detect any potential incidences of fuel escape. By identifying the distinctive odor of natural gas, which is similar to the smell of rotten eggs, you can act upon proper actions and inform the involved authorities instantly. Keep in mind that the safety of everybody around you relies on your ability to sense the smell of pure gas quickly.
Make sure to remain vigilant and rapidly respond if you whenever come across the distinctive smell of organic gas. Swift response is crucial in making sure the safety
of you and people surrounding you. Right away, move the location and reach out to urgent assistance to report the gas issue as soon as you notice the scent. Recall to stay away from any open flames or electrical devices that could potentially ignite the gas in case there is a leakage. Stay safe and do not ever underestimate the severity of a organic fuel smell since it could indicate an emergency.
